City: The total cost of establishing a coffee house also depends on the city where you are going to establish your business.

If it is a small city then you can begin with an investment of 10 lakh rupees even. And, in case you want to start your shop at a big Indian city or a metro city then get ready to shed at least 20 Lakh for the overall investment.

Here are some ranges for the costs of opening various types of coffee businesses:

cafe chains

  • Coffee kiosk: 6 to 10 Lakh
  • Mobile coffee food truck: 3 to 6 Lakh

  • Coffee shop with seating: 6 to 30 Lakh

  • Coffee shop with seating and drive-thru: 15 to 30 Lakh

If you already own a suitable building or have a complementary business such as a bakery, your costs might be much lower.

If you want to add a brew bar to your franchise business of coffee chains in India, add about 2 to 3 Lakh to your initial costs. In addition to start-up costs, you should have cash on hand to cover all of your operating expenses for the first six months.

These are the final factors that affect the cost of your coffee house. As per your need, desire and budget you can change the same.

  • Rent and build-out costs for your chosen location. As a rule, rent should be no more than 15 percent of projected sales.

  • Coffee Shop Equipment, including a top-of-the-line espresso machine, espresso and coffee grinders, blenders, gourmet drip in the franchise for coffee chains in India.

  • Coffee, milk, chocolate, syrups, and other drink ingredients as well as pastries, muffins and other baked goods, which should be no more than 40 percent of projected sales.

  • Professional fees for architects, attorneys, accountants, and business consultants.

  • Payroll costs, including wages, benefits, payroll taxes, worker’s compensation and costs of payroll processing. As a rule of thumb, payroll costs should be 35 percent or less of sales.

  • Principal and interest costs (if you plan to borrow money).

  • Income taxes (usually about 35 percent of operating profit).

  • Other expenses, including business insurance, supplies (napkins, stir sticks, porcelain cups, etc.), licenses and permits, office supplies, utilities, advertising, and repairs and maintenance.
